Lever Handle Lock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ide
Lever handle locks are a necessary component of a secure home or office environment. However, like all mechanical gadgets, they can break or end up being damaged gradually. When this occurs, changing the lock is necessary to maintain security and performance. This post will direct you through the procedure of lever handle lock replacement, highlighting the tools needed, actions to take, and providing some practical tips.
Comprehending Lever Handle Locks
Before diving into the replacement process, it's vital to comprehend what lever handle locks are. These locks normally include 2 primary components: the lever handle and the locking mechanism. Lever handle locks are favored for their ease of use, requiring only a push or pull to operate, making them appropriate for both residential and commercial homes. They can be discovered on interior and exterior doors and differ in style, surface, and security features.

Before beginning the replacement procedure, collect the needed tools and materials to guarantee a smooth experience.
Tools: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ips head)Allen wrench (if needed)Tape stepLevel (optional)Materials:New lever handle lockReplacement screws (if needed)Lubricant (optional, for smoother operation)Step-by-Step Replacement ProcessStep 1: Remove the Old Lock
Unscrew the Handle:.Utilize the screwdriver to remove the screws located on the interior side of the lever handle lock. Hold the lever securely while unscrewing to avoid it from falling.

Remove the Lever Handle:.When unscrewed, pull the lever handle away from the door. You may require to carefully twist or lift it off the spindle.

Remove the Lock Cylinder:.If your lock has a visible cylinder, remove it by loosening it from the door. Some locks may have a keeping clip that needs removal initially.

Extract the Latch:.Open the door and locate the latch mechanism inside the door edge. Unscrew it and pull it out.
Action 2: Prepare the Door
Inspect the Door:.Before setting up the new lock, check the door hole for damage. Usage wood filler if there are significant cracks or use.

Tidy the Area:.Clean down the location where the new lock will be installed to ensure a clean fit.
Step 3: Install the New Lock
Place the Latch:.Position the new latch into the door edge, guaranteeing it lines up with the existing holes. Secure it with screws.

Set up the Cylinder:.If your new lock has a different cylinder, insert it now according to the particular producer instructions.

Attach the Lever Handle:.Line up the lever handle with the spindle and press it onto the locking mechanism. Secure it with screws.

Evaluate the Mechanism:.Before closing the door, rotate the lever handle to ensure it functions smoothly. If it does not, confirm your installation.
Step 4: Finish Up
Last Checks:.Make sure all screws are tightened up which the handle operates correctly. Make adjustments as necessary.

Oil:.For optimum efficiency, apply a little quantity of lube to the moving parts of the lock.
Frequently Asked Questions about Lever Handle Lock Replacement1. How do I choose the ideal replacement lever handle lock?
When selecting a new lock, consider:
The size of the existing hole.The type of latch required (backset).Security functions (e.g., deadbolt alternatives).Visual considerations to match your decoration.2. Can I change a lever lock myself, or should I hire a professional?
If you have standard tools and a little mechanical ability, you can finish the replacement yourself. However, if you are uneasy with DIY jobs or have a high-security lock, it might be best to work with a locksmith.
3. Just how much does it usually cost to replace a lever handle lock?
The cost can differ widely:
Basic lever handle locks begin around ₤ 20 to ₤ 50.Higher security or specialized locks can v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 or more.Employing a locksmith might include labor costs of 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 depending on your area.4. What should I do if the new lock does not fit?
If the new lock size does not match the old lock's footprint:
Consider using a conversion package.Make small changes to the hole (if it's bigger).Seek advice from a professional locksmith.5. How frequently should I replace my lever handle locks?
Normally, it's advised to evaluate your locks every 3-5 years for wear and tear. If residing in a high-crime location or after losing keys, think about more frequent replacements.
